Keep your laundry room clean and clutter-free by setting aside a designated spot for dirty laundry. Additionally, make use of vertical space by installing hooks to hang up ironing boards and brooms. You could also invest in a hanging rack or over-the-door organisers to keep ironing board covers, laundry bags and other items off the floor. Consider adding shelving or baskets to hold detergents, fabric softeners and other laundry supplies.
